HEIK – Knafeh Culture, La Mer

The traditional Levantine dessert ‘knafeh’ gets a modern twist @heikculture @lamer                                                                      La Mer at sunset ..... Baked on order, the traditional knafeh can be had along with no-sugar added syrups and various toppings like pistachios, pecans etc. There are four flavours of syrups to choose from - orange blossom, honey cinnamon, lavender and cardomom.
